Synopsis:
You came, you saw you conquered all before you, or so the stories in the shadows go on to tell of it. Hell they even went and based a trid off it though no one dared step forward and take credit for the job much less would talk to anyone in the media about what you did. The reason why? Your team pulled off the impossible. Working together you pulled off and survived the 'dream job' the job that would set you up for life, and it sure as hell did! The downside is, some one's always really really pissed off at you as a result, but you were good, you were careful. You covered your tracks and no one, not even your employers were sure who you were or what you looked like. In many ways, what made it all possible was The Crash 2.0. The second great Crash wiped out any information on you, and those in your team. Gave you a clean slate to start anew with none the wiser and anyone else who was either wasn't about to talk, or by now was 6 feet under.

Now? Now was the time to live it up, to live the good life, the life many only dream of. The life you dreamed of. Sure it wasn't quite the absolute lap of luxury, but you had more than enough money to not complain about it. Life is good, and had been for several years now. No frets, no worries. The money would take care of everything!

At least, that is until just now, when you receive an odd message left on your comlink.

'A Missed Call.'

Background on 'the big score'

The job had been fairly straightforward as such things go, and the pay had been amazing. That said the job had also not been simple, and not everyone made it out in one piece. The crew, initially composed of 9 individuals was these days down to 7, and not everyone bothered to keep in touch once the job was done. The score had taken 9 months to put together and execute to completion, but it had gone through almost flawlessly until the end which came in the form of a late night raid on a large privately owned compound outside of Seattle. All that had to be done was steal some old relic from Egypt out of a private collection, but what had made the job even more difficult was the fact that the target was already aware, and alert for trouble. Two other teams had tried before, and all had failed. Silencing the survivors of the previous groups had in fact been part of the initial job. Your employer had wanted to be quite sure no one who had failed was left to talk, and your team had wound up so certain that your employer would turn on you, that once the run was over everyone broke up and went their separate ways into a new life. Crash 2.0 had just bought you considerably more added security as an unexpected bonus.

Herman Jester was the man who's home you were raiding, a self styled business tycoon who had done quite well for himself and had a penchant for collecting ancient artifacts for his private collection, mostly focusing on ancient Egypt and Greece. While the man's personal tastes were still high end, they weren't among the richest of the rich. His security on the other hand had been an entirely different matter. What the man didn't spend on lavish foods and entertainment, he'd spent on security. Surveillance of the grounds had been a nightmare with all the measures in place, and the place was as solidly built as a home could be without being called a military bunker. The only things working in your favour was that there had been no neighbours to worry about for a good fifty acres in all directions. That and one of the team's Deckers Fractyl had managed to dig up some early plans for the home which had included the location of an escape tunnel. That tunnel ultimately served as the group's way in, but that's where things started to go wrong.

Early on Fractyl bit the dust to some nasty black IC. Blip, the group's mechanic went down to an explosion apparently triggered by a security drone while the team was escaping out through a hole in the wall Spade had breached in Herman Jester's personal hydroponics farm. From there the team had to get across a literal open killing field while being perused by a small private army that had sported weaponry and armour more suited to an army black ops unit than a private security force. Despite all that however, the rest of the team made it out, though afterwards Spade was never quite himself. Then again the human cybersam had shown signs of cracking before then, but had gone in on the 'big heist' as one last job to set himself up for life. At the end of the run the drop was made, though there hadn't been much time to examine the stolen relic. Everyone had had an uneasy feel about it though and most certainly the mages. Still, the money was just too good to pass up and the J (who had, as far as anyone on the team could tell was some how connected to SK), surprisingly enough actually paid up and left as quickly as possible, all without the all too expected ambush.

While some of the old team had kept in touch, the last anyone had heard of Spade was that he'd spent most of his money on booze, drugs, hookers and parties rather than wisely investing. Rumours had started to circle that he was getting in debt and even more trouble before he finally seemed to find some sort of balance in his life.

Still, it came as no surprise then, that on the heels of the creepy message left on everyone's coms, that he called up wanting everyone to meet at an old abandoned warehouse in Carbonado in the Pullyup barrens. Not the safest place to go, but at the same time it was far enough away from everything and so sparsely populated that it was unlikely a place where you'd pick up a tail and not notice it. The fact that it was dotted with old abandoned mines, warehouses and other facilities had made it a favourite place to go for smugglers and other sorts, so the choice of location at least made some sense. All the volcanic ash and pollution out that way however did make some sort of breathing mask not only wise, but flat out necessary.

The warehouse Spade asked everyone to come to was a drek hole and a half, and had clearly been abandoned for years. Volcanic ash and accumulated dust covered everything, though there were signs of some transient life and most of the volcanic ash at least stayed outside of the building. That however probably accounted for all the damn rats clearly crawling all over the place though they seemed mostly docile and harmless. You couldn't go 20 feet without seeing at least one rat somewhere, along with all sorts of accumulated trash. There also wasn't much in the way of cover, some collapsed storage racking here, an abandoned desk there, an overturned and broken picnic table that had come from... who knows where, some old dilapidated filing cabinets. The structure seemed to be in really poor shape and it was a wonder the whole thing was still standing as there were holes in the wall, obvious signs of serious water damage and a really high chance of some nasty mould or something growing inside what few walls there were. Beyond that most of the building was totally empty, just one big room, though there was a small two tiered office space area off on the north side, though it was questionable as to how safe it would be to enter as it looked in even worse shape than the rest of the building having suffered the worst of the decay over the years.

And the place smelled.

Bad.

Beyond that, Spade was so far nowhere to be seen. At least the place was in the middle of nowhere so beyond a few hills and dips it should theoretically be pretty easy to see anyone coming before they arrived.
